Could you—or someone you care about—be in burnout and not even know it?


In this powerful episode of Beyond Chronic Burnout, Carole Jean Whittington, Lead Burnout Researcher and Chief Well-Being Officer at Whittington Well-Being, brings her recent presentation from the 2nd Annual International Autism Summit straight to you. 🔥


She introduces the Spicy Pepper Scale, a new tool to help identify the stages of burnout, from barely-there to blazing-hot. With over 85% of autistic individuals potentially experiencing Spicy Burnout, it’s time we start calling it what it is—and more importantly, doing something about it.


You'll learn:

  • 🔎 Why burnout often goes unrecognized in autistic people

  • 🌶️ How the Spicy Pepper Scale helps you pinpoint where you are

  • 🧠 The impact of masking, sensory overwhelm, and health overlap

  • ⚙️ How The UnVeiling Method + Rapid Recharge Lab are changing the game in burnout recovery

This is more than a conversation—it’s a wake-up call filled with practical strategies and hope. Plus, Carole Jean shares tools, quizzes, and a sneak peek at her upcoming book to support your journey toward sustainable energy and safety.
